Annotated Snippet

struct dcn31_resource_pool {
	struct resource_pool base;
};

enum dc_status dcn31_validate_bandwidth(struct dc *dc,
		struct dc_state *context,
		enum dc_validate_mode validate_mode);
void dcn31_calculate_wm_and_dlg(
		struct dc *dc, struct dc_state *context,
		display_e2e_pipe_params_st *pipes,
		int pipe_cnt,
		int vlevel);
int dcn31_populate_dml_pipes_from_context(
	struct dc *dc, struct dc_state *context,
	display_e2e_pipe_params_st *pipes,
	enum dc_validate_mode validate_mode);
void
dcn31_populate_dml_writeback_from_context(struct dc *dc,
					  struct resource_context *res_ctx,
					  display_e2e_pipe_params_st *pipes);
void
dcn31_set_mcif_arb_params(struct dc *dc,
			  struct dc_state *context,
			  display_e2e_pipe_params_st *pipes,
			  int pipe_cnt);

struct resource_pool *dcn31_create_resource_pool(
		const struct dc_init_data *init_data,
		struct dc *dc);

unsigned int dcn31_get_det_buffer_size(
	const struct dc_state *context);

enum dc_status dcn31_update_dc_state_for_encoder_switch(struct dc_link *link,
	struct dc_link_settings *link_setting,
	uint8_t pipe_count,
	struct pipe_ctx *pipes,
	struct audio_output *audio_output);
